Expert Strategy for Texas Hold’em at Casino Ya

Texas Hold’em remains the most popular variant, and the player pool at Casino Ya Poker offers a mix of recreational players and grinders. To achieve consistent profitability, you must adapt your strategy to the specific tendencies of this site. The key observation is that many players at the lower stakes are overly passive, calling too frequently and folding too rarely. This creates an ideal environment for a value-heavy betting strategy.

From early position, tighten your opening range significantly. In a standard 6-max cash game, I recommend opening only the top 12–15% of hands from under the gun. This includes premium pairs, strong suited connectors, and high card combinations. The reason is simple: you will often face multiple callers, and playing marginal hands out of position is a recipe for losing money. When you do enter a pot, be prepared to continuation bet on flops that favour your range, particularly on boards with low cards.

In late position, you can open more liberally, targeting the blinds and weak limpers. A standard button opening range should include about 40% of hands, but you must be disciplined about folding to three-bets from the blinds. A frequent mistake at Casino Ya is over-defending the big blind against late position raises. Your defence range should be polarised: you want to three-bet your strongest hands and fold the weakest, while calling with a balanced selection of medium-strength holdings.

Exploiting Common Leaks in the Player Pool

The average player at Casino Ya has two major leaks: they call too many river bets with weak pairs, and they chase draws without proper pot odds. To exploit the first leak, you should increase your value betting frequency on the river. If you believe your opponent has a medium-strength hand, a bet of 60–75% of the pot will often get called by hands you beat. Conversely, you should bluff less frequently, as the population under-folds to river bets.

Regarding draws, many players overestimate their implied odds. They will call large bets on the flop with gutshot straight draws or backdoor flush draws, hoping to hit a big hand. Your strategy should be to charge them the maximum price. Bet 70–80% of the pot on the flop and turn to ensure that any call is mathematically incorrect in the long run. Over time, these small edges accumulate into significant profit.

Finally, pay attention to table selection. The lobby allows you to see the average pot size and the number of players seeing the flop. Target tables where the average pot is high and the flop percentage exceeds 30%. These are indicators of loose, passive players who are likely to make costly mistakes.

Advanced Tips for Omaha and Stud Poker Games

Pot-Limit Omaha (PLO) is a game of high variance and requires a fundamentally different mindset than Hold’em. The cardinal rule in PLO is to avoid playing weak hands. In Hold’em, you can occasionally win with a weak pair; in Omaha, you need strong draws and made hands. A good starting hand in PLO must have connectivity, suitedness, and pair potential. Hands like A♠K♠Q♥J♦ are premium, while A♠K♠7♣2♦ is a trap hand that will cost you money.

Position is even more critical in PLO than in Hold’em. You should play a wider range from late position and a much tighter range from early position. When you are out of position, you must be prepared to check-fold frequently, especially on dangerous boards. Aggression is key in PLO; you want to be the one betting and raising, not calling. Calling stations are punished severely in this game because the variance is so high.

For Seven-Card Stud, the meta at Casino Ya is relatively small, but the game offers excellent opportunities for observant players. The key skill in Stud is reading exposed cards. You must keep track of which cards are dead (folded or in opponents’ hands) and adjust your starting hand requirements accordingly. For example, if several low cards are dead, your low draws become less valuable. Similarly, if a player shows an Ace, they likely have a strong starting hand, and you should proceed with caution.

Bankroll Management Techniques for Long-Term Success

Bankroll management is the single most important discipline for any poker player, yet it is the most neglected. Without proper bankroll management, even the most skilled player will eventually go broke due to variance. The golden rule is to never risk more than 5% of your total bankroll in a single cash game session, and no more than 2% in a single tournament buy-in.

For cash games, I recommend a bankroll of at least 20 buy-ins for your chosen stake level. For example, if you play €0.10/€0.25 NLHE, you need a minimum of €500. However, 30 buy-ins is a safer threshold, especially if you are multi-tabling. For tournaments, the recommended bankroll is 100 buy-ins, given the higher variance. A €10 tournament player should therefore have at least €1,000 in their poker bankroll.

It is also essential to practice discipline when moving up in stakes. Do not move up simply because you have had a winning session. Use a clear rule: move up only when you have 30 buy-ins for the next level, and move back down if you lose 10 buy-ins at that higher level. This „stop-loss“ approach prevents you from chasing losses and protects your bankroll during downswings.

Reading Opponents and Table Dynamics

Online poker limits the physical tells available in live games, but it compensates with a wealth of statistical data. The most valuable tool at your disposal is the player notes feature. Every time you observe a significant hand, make a note. For example, „calls three-bets out of position with weak Ace“ or „bluffs river with missed draw.“ Over time, these notes build a detailed profile that you can exploit.

Beyond notes, pay attention to betting patterns. A player who bets quickly is likely using a standard line, while a player who pauses may be making a deliberate decision. Timing tells are not infallible, but they offer clues. For instance, a player who insta-checks on the flop but then bets after a long pause on the turn may be attempting a delayed continuation bet. Similarly, a player who snap-calls a river bet with a weak hand is likely a calling station.

Table dynamics also shift based on the number of players. In a full-ring game (9-handed), you should play tighter and focus on position. In a short-handed game (5–6 players), aggression is rewarded, and you can open wider ranges. Pay attention to how the table adapts to you. If players are three-betting you frequently, tighten up and trap them. If they are folding too often, increase your bluff frequency.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Online Poker

Even experienced players fall into predictable traps. The most common mistake is playing too many hands from early position. This is especially prevalent among players transitioning from live to online poker. The pace of online play is faster, and the temptation to get involved in every hand is strong. Resist this urge. Fold pre-flop from early position with all but your strongest holdings.

Another frequent error is failing to adjust to different table dynamics. You cannot use the same strategy against a table of tight-aggressive players as you would against a table of loose-passive players. Against tight players, you should steal blinds more frequently and reduce your value betting. Against loose players, you should tighten your range and increase your bet sizing for value.

  • Overvaluing suited cards: Suited hands are only about 2–4% stronger than offsuit hands. Do not play weak suited hands simply because they are suited.
  • Chasing draws without pot odds: Always calculate your pot odds before calling a bet with a draw. If the pot is offering insufficient odds, fold.
  • Tilting after a bad beat: Variance is part of the game. If you feel yourself tilting, close the software and take a break. Playing while tilted is the fastest way to lose money.
  • Ignoring table selection: The most profitable players spend significant time selecting the right tables. Do not sit at the first available table; look for soft games.
